18. There was an army of police out there this evening |
|
They were trucked in from all over the place, all in heavy duty riot gear (must have been boiling inside of those things). I went up to one of them and asked if something evil had happened or was about to happen, and he said no, it was just preventative. Tom Hayden spoke about how it was in 1968, and said that these guys had been pre-programmed to expect and therefore give back violence. I did see a few bandit-masked types, but there were very few (less than ten) that I saw, and so far no provocations and no reactions.
Still, if these guys are there in full battle gear and completely on edge, it won't take much to set them off. So far, I just engage them in conversation, ask a question, just say, "got it, thanks, man!" and act as if they were fellow tourists instead of a force armed to the teeth. So far, mellow begets mellow. I realize that could change at any second.
